STATE COLLEGE, PA., OCT. 24, 2003- Penn State sophomore Dan Mazzocco (Pittsburgh, Pa.) continued his return to cross country this week after being named the Big Ten Cross Country Co-Athlete of the Week by the conference. Mazzocco led 218 competitors at the Penn State National on Oct. 18 with a career-best time on the home course of 25:29.69. Mazzocco shared the honor with Michigan's Nick Willis, who recorded the top time by a Big Ten competitor at the Pre-Nationals in Cedar Falls, Iowa over the weekend. This is the second Big Ten Cross Country Athlete of the Week honor for Mazzocco this season. The first came after he won the Penn State Spiked Shoe and led the Nittany Lions to a team victory on Sept. 13. Penn State is back in action on Nov. 2 for the Big Ten Championships hosted by Michigan State University.
